mixhostでサブドメインを作成する方法は?SSL設定も解説

当ページのリンクには広告が含まれる場合があります。
オフィスにある沢山のパソコン

mixhostでサブドメインを作成したいけど、cPanelのどこから設定すればいいかわからないし、そもそもサブドメインとサブディレクトリのどちらがSEOに有利なのかも気になります。

こうした疑問に答えます。

本記事の内容
  • サブドメインとサブディレクトリの違い
  • ミックスホストサブドメインの具体的な作成手順
  • サブドメインが正しく表示されないときの対処法

mixhostならcpanelからサブドメインを簡単に作成できます。WordPressの設置やSSL設定も自動で行えるため、初心者でも安心してサブドメインを運用できます。

SEOや用途に応じたサブドメイン活用法も解説しているので、ぜひ最後までご覧ください。マルチドメインの運用を考えている方にも役立つ内容となっています。

目次

mixhostでサブドメインを作成する前に知っておくべきこと

mixhostのビルの間で飛び交うネットワーク

mixhostでサブドメインを作成する前に、まずサブドメインの基本的な仕組みやサブディレクトリとの違い、SEOや運用面の注意点を理解することが重要です。

これを理解せずに設定を進めると、目的に合わないサイト運営や予期せぬSEO上のリスクが生じる可能性があります。

サブドメインとは?ドメインとの関係性を解説

サブドメインとは、主ドメインの前に好きな文字列を付与することで、主ドメインとは区切られた別のスペースを作れる仕組みです。例えば、ドメインが「example.com」の場合、「blog.example.com」や「shop.example.com」といった形で複数のサイトを運営できます。

ミックスホストでサブドメインを利用すれば、用途や目的ごとにサイト内容を分けて管理できるため、テスト環境・会員サイト・多言語サイトなどに多く用いられています。

サブドメインとサブディレクトリの明確な違い

サブドメインとサブディレクトリは、サイト構造の設計やSEOの評価方法に違いがあります。mixhostでサブドメインWordPressを運用する際は、以下の違いを理解しておくことが重要です。

スクロールできます
項目サブドメイン(blog.example.com)サブディレクトリ(example.com/blog)
URL構造ドメインの前に指定した文字列ドメインの後ろにディレクトリ名
サイト管理本体サイトと完全に分離が可能本体サイトと一体で管理
WordPress設置別々のインストールが必要同じWordPress内でも運用可能
SEOの扱い原則として別サイトとみなされる本体サイトの1コンテンツとみなされる
管理や運用コストやや高い比較的低い

このように、mixhostサブドメインは独立性が高いためテスト環境や新規プロジェクトの立ち上げ時に便利です。ただし、サブディレクトリ型に比べて管理の手間やSEOへの影響が異なる点に注意が必要です。

SEOの観点から見た使い分けの基準

SEOの観点では、「どちらが有利か」という絶対的な答えはありませんが、Googleはサブドメインを原則「別サイト」として評価します。一方、サブディレクトリは本サイトの一部として認識される傾向があり、コンテンツ全体のボリューム感やドメインパワーを集中させたい場合に向いています。

mixhostサブドメインを使うのに適したケース

  • サイトのテーマや目的が本体サイトと明確に異なる
  • テストサイトや一時的なキャンペーンページの運用
  • 多言語展開や会員制サイトなど、構造上完全に分離したい場合

サブディレクトリが向いているケース

  • ジャンル・商品毎の細分化やブログの分類など、本サイトの一部として情報を追加したい場合
  • SEO評価を既存サイトと共有したい場合

運用目的や将来的なサイト構成によって、適切に選択してください。

アドオンドメインとの違いも理解しよう

アドオンドメインとは、1つのサーバーアカウント内で複数の全く異なるドメイン(例:example.comとsample.jpなど)を運用できる機能です。サブドメインは1つのドメイン内で領域を分割するのに対し、アドオンドメインはまったく別ドメインの管理・運用が可能です。

スクロールできます
項目サブドメインアドオンドメイン
利用ドメイン数1つのドメイン内複数の異なるドメイン
運営サイト数無制限に増やせる(本体の一部)本体とは全く別の新しいサイトとして独立運営可
代表的用途サイトの機能追加・多言語・会員制別事業・別ブランド等完全新サイト

以上から、ミックスホストでサブドメインを利用する場合は、自身の運用目的・SEOによる影響・管理のしやすさをトータルに考慮し、最適な設計を検討しましょう。

mixhostのサブドメイン設定手順を画像付きで解説

mixhostでサブドメインを追加する工程は非常にシンプルです。cPanelの仕様変更も多いため、最新の流れで正しく進めることがポイント。

ここでは、ミックスホストのcPanelを使ったサブドメイン作成手順を、実際の画面操作にそって詳しく解説します。

①:mixhostのcPanelにログインする

まずはmixhostのマイページにアクセス。「cPanelにログイン」をクリックしてください。

cPanelはmixhostが提供する管理画面です。この中でサブドメインの追加やドメイン管理を行います。

②:「サブドメイン」メニューを選択する

cPanelのホーム画面が表示されたら、「ドメイン」セクションを探します。その中にある「サブドメイン」もしくは「ドメイン」をクリック。

仕様変更により表記が変わる場合があります。いずれかのメニューからサブドメイン設定ページへ進んでください。

③:作成したいサブドメイン名を入力する

サブドメイン作成画面では、「新しいドメインを作成」もしくは「サブドメイン名の入力」といった欄が表示されます。ここに、追加したいサブドメインを半角英数字で入力。

例えば、blog.example.comなら「blog」と入力してください。必要に応じて、対象ドメインをプルダウンから選択します。入力後は「送信」または「作成」ボタンをクリック。

④:ドキュメントルートを確認して作成を完了する

mixhostサブドメイン用のドキュメントルートは自動で割り当てられます。「ドキュメントルート」のオプション欄が表示された場合は、初期設定のままで問題ありません。

通常はチェックを外すなど特別な設定変更は不要。「送信」や「作成」ボタンを押せば完了です。成功のメッセージが表示されれば、無事にmixhostサブドメインが作成されています。

サブドメイン作成後、即座に反映されない場合やSSLが適用されない場合は、最大72時間程度待つ必要があります。サブドメイン名の形式や文字数にも注意してください。不明点があればmixhostサポートの活用もおすすめです。

mixhostのサブドメイン作成後に必要な設定

mixhostでサブドメインを作成した後、安定したサイト運営のためには追加設定が必要です。WordPressの導入、SSL化、DNS反映の確認が重要になります。

ここでは、それぞれの手順と注意点を詳しく解説します。

サブドメインにWordPressをインストールする方法

mixhostサブドメインを利用して新たにブログやテストサイトを立ち上げる場合、WordPressのインストールが一般的です。サブドメインは本体ドメインとは異なる用途や目的で運用されるケースが多く、WordPressの個別管理がしやすいメリットがあります。

手順は以下の通りです。

  1. mixhostのcPanelにログインする
  2. ホーム画面から「ソフトウェア」カテゴリ内の「WordPress Manager by Softaculous」または「Softaculous Apps Installer」を選択
  3. 「インストール」ボタンを押し、インストールしたいサブドメインを選択
  4. 管理者ユーザー名やパスワード、サイト名などを入力してインストールを実行

WordPressインストール後は、サブドメイン毎に独立したWebサイトとして管理できます。マルチドメインや複数の用途でmixhostサブドメインを使いたい場合に非常に便利です。

無料独自SSLを設定してサイトを常時SSL化する

サブドメインにWordPressをインストールした後は、セキュリティ強化とGoogle検索順位を考慮したmixhostサブドメインssl化が必須となります。mixhostではLet’s Encryptによる無料独自SSLを簡単に設定できます。

SSL設定の流れは以下となります。

  1. サブドメイン作成からSSLが有効になるまで、通常は24~72時間程度かかる場合がある
  2. cPanelメニューの「セキュリティ」内から「SSL/TLS」または「SSL/TLS Status」をクリック
  3. サブドメインが一覧に表示されていることを確認し、「Install SSL」や「Run AutoSSL」ボタンを押してSSL証明書を自動取得・適用
  4. WordPressの管理画面から「一般」設定で、URLが「https://」になっているかも確認

もしSSLが正常に認証されない場合、サブドメイン名の間違いや設定直後の反映待ちの問題が考えられます。サブドメイン名は64文字未満に抑えましょう。

トラブル時はmixhostサポートへ早めに連絡することで迅速な解決が可能です。

DNS設定の反映を確認する手順

mixhostサブドメイン作成やSSL設定直後は、DNS情報がインターネット全体へ行き渡るまでに時間がかかります。正しく反映されているかどうか確認し、問題があれば迅速に対処することが重要です。

  1. まずWebブラウザでサブドメインのURLにアクセスし、サイトが正しく表示されるか確認
  2. ブラウザがキャッシュを保持している場合、強制リロード(Ctrl+F5)やシークレットウィンドウでの表示を確認
  3. さらにDNSの反映状況を外部サービス(「DNSチェッカー」や「nslookup」コマンド)などで調査することも有効
  4. サブドメインが反映されていない場合、最大72時間程度待つ必要がある。反映後も表示されない場合は、DNS設定の誤りやドキュメントルートの指定ミスなどを再確認

これらの手順を落ち着いて実施することで、ミックスホストサブドメインを安定して使い始められます。cpanelサブドメインの管理も含めて、mixhostサブドメイン作成後の設定は確実に行いましょう。

mixhostでサブドメインが表示されない時の原因と対処法

mixhostでサブドメインを作成したのに表示されない場合、いくつかの典型的な原因があります。これらの原因を把握して適切に対処することで、トラブルを解消できます。

原因①:DNS設定が浸透していない

サブドメインが表示されない主な理由は、DNS設定の浸透が完了していないこと。サブドメインを作成すると、DNSに新しい設定情報が反映されます。

世界中のDNSサーバーに設定が行き渡るまで、一般的に24〜72時間かかります。

  • サブドメインを作成してすぐはアクセスできないのが普通
  • 数時間から最大3日程度は待つ
  • 待っても改善しない場合、DNS設定に漏れや誤りがないか再確認

原因②:ドキュメントルートの指定が間違っている

mixhostではサブドメインごとにドキュメントルートを指定します。このディレクトリ指定が間違っていると、意図したファイルが読み込まれません。

  • cPanelでミックスホストサブドメイン作成時、ドキュメントルートの項目は初期値のままにしておく
  • サブドメインごとに独立したフォルダが作成される
  • 作成済みサブドメインのドキュメントルートは、cPanel上でいつでも確認・修正可能

原因③:SSL証明書が正しく発行されていない

mixhostサブドメインにSSLを有効化したい場合、自動的に無料SSL証明書が発行されます。設定直後はまだ反映されていない可能性があります。

  • mixhostサブドメイン作成直後は、SSLが完全に反映されるまで最大72時間かかる
  • サブドメイン名やドメインの文字列・長さに問題があると認証エラーになる
  • しばらく待ってもhttps接続ができない場合、cPanelの「SSL/TLSステータス」で手動で再発行を試す
  • それでも解決しない場合は、mixhostのサポートに連絡

原因④:.htaccessファイルに問題がある

サブドメインやドキュメントルート内の.htaccessファイルに誤記述がある場合も、正しくページが表示されません。

  • サブドメイン用ディレクトリに設置した.htaccessを確認
  • 不要なリダイレクトやエラーを引き起こす記述があれば削除または修正
  • .htaccessの記述ミスはサーバー全体に影響を与える可能性があるため、編集後は必ず動作確認

初心者の方でも上記のポイントを順番に確認することで、多くのトラブルが解決できます。どうしても原因が特定できない場合は、mixhostのサポートへ問い合わせを行い、現状と試した対処法を詳細に伝えましょう。

mixhostのサブドメインを有効活用するためのヒント

mixhostの文字が並んでいる

mixhostでサブドメインを活用することで、既存ドメインの枠を超えた多様なサイト運営や新しいWeb施策が実現できます。以下に具体的な使い方・注意点・管理ノウハウを紹介します。

サブドメインの具体的な活用事例を紹介

サブドメインは、独自ドメインの前に任意の文字列をつけて新しい区分を作る仕組みです。異なる目的やサイトごとの区分として利用されます。

  • テスト環境
    新しいテーマやプラグインの動作確認、本番公開前のWordPressテスト環境として、test.example.com などのmixhostサブドメインを作成できます。
  • 多言語サイト
    日本語サイト(example.com)と英語サイト(en.example.com)など、言語ごとにサブドメインを分けてグローバル展開を実現できます。
  • 会員制サイトやサービス
    community.example.com などで独立した会員サイトやサービス専用機能を持たせることも可能です。

このようにミックスホストのサブドメインは、目的別運用やSEO施策、多店舗展開など多彩な使い方ができます。

サイトの目的別に見るセキュリティ対策

サブドメインごとに役割や運用者が異なる場合、セキュリティ対策も個別に検討しましょう。

複数のWordPressインストール時は、それぞれの管理画面やプラグインアップデート・バックアップ設定も独立して行います。mixhostサブドメインごとに無料SSL認証(Let’s Encryptなど)を必ず有効化し、HTTPS化して通信の安全を確保します。

不要なプラグインやテーマは削除し、脆弱性リスクを低減しましょう。管理者権限の分散やアクセス制限、二段階認証なども効果的です。

目的や公開範囲に応じて、セキュリティ対応を怠らないことが、安全なサイト運営には不可欠です。

サブドメインごとのバックアップと管理方法

サブドメインを増やすごとに、運営・管理の複雑さも増します。効率的かつ安全な運用のため、以下を意識してください。

mixhostではcpanelからサブドメインごとにデータのバックアップが可能です。WordPress利用時は、プラグインやcpanelの「バックアップ」機能を組み合わせて定期的に保存しましょう。

ファイルやデータベースは本体ドメインとサブドメインで分かれるため、誤って消去しないようディレクトリ構成を確認して管理してください。サブドメインごとのアクセス解析や運用ログを取得する設定もおすすめです。

このように、サブドメインを適切に管理することで、万が一のトラブル時にも迅速な復旧や運用継続が行えます。

mixhostサブドメイン作成・管理・運用には、基本操作だけでなく、目的に応じた活用とセキュリティ・バックアップ体制の構築が重要です。マルチドメインmixhostのcpanel機能を活用することで、専門知識がなくても安心して多彩なWeb展開を実現できます。

まとめ:mixhostのサブドメインはcPanelから簡単作成可能

mixhostサブドメインの設定は、cPanelからの直感的な操作により初心者でも安心して進められます。

基本的なmixhostサブドメイン作成からWordPressインストール、無料SSL設定、トラブル対応まで詳しく解説しました。目的や活用方法に応じてミックスホストサブドメインを最大限活用できるはず。

本記事のポイント
  • mixhostサブドメインはcpanelサブドメイン機能から数ステップで簡単に作成可能
  • mixhostサブドメインSSL設定やWordPressインストールなど、運用に必要な手順もすべてcPanel上で完結
  • マルチドメインmixhost環境でのトラブル原因や活用事例、管理のコツまで幅広く解説済み

これでmixhostサブドメインに関する疑問や悩みを、自分で解決できるようになります。

ぜひこの記事を参考に、あなたのmixhostサブドメイン作成と運用をスムーズに始めてください。

よかったらシェアしてください!
  • URLをコピーしました!
目次